Featured Listings
Long Island S B S Ltd in Outer Hebrides, Scotland
Long Island S B S Ltd with information like telephone number, maps, postcode, address and related useful information.
Long Island S B S Ltd with information like telephone number, maps, postcode, address and related useful information.